Japan Golf Passport

Free etiquette certification for foreign golfers visiting Japan. Take a 20-question quiz, pass, and receive a digital certificate proving you understand Japanese golf customs.

What it is: The Japan Golf Passport is a free online certification quiz created by GolfMatchy. It covers the six key areas of Japanese golf etiquette that trip up overseas visitors most often — from dress code and arrival procedures to the compulsory mid-round lunch, caddie customs, and post-round onsen manners. Pass with 80% or higher and receive a shareable digital certificate. It takes about 10–15 minutes and there are unlimited free retries.

What the Quiz Covers (6 Parts)

  1. Part 1: Planning Your Trip
    Booking methods, lead times, costs, and what to expect before you arrive.
  2. Part 2: Arrival & Dress Code
    Check-in procedures, compulsory spike-free shoes, collar requirements, and locker etiquette.
  3. Part 3: On the Course
    Pace of play, divot repair, cart rules, caddie etiquette, and course-specific customs.
  4. Part 4: Meal Break
    The mandatory mid-round lunch between holes 9 and 10 — what to eat, how to order, and timing.
  5. Part 5: After Golf & Onsen
    Clubhouse bathing customs, changing room manners, and post-round payment.
  6. Part 6: Bonus Phrases
    Useful Japanese golf phrases to impress your playing partners and course staff.
